The most prominent constituents of … WebAug 31, 2016 · Canine basophils also occasionally lack obvious granules but are recognizable by their size, nuclear morphology, and cytoplasmic staining (Figure 26-16). In cats, basophils contain abundant oval, pale lavender to gray specific granules ( Figure 26-17 ), although immature basophils may also contain a few primary, dark purple granules.

WebBasophils are rare in normal dogs and cats. Basophilia is the presence of greater than or equal to 2% basophils or repeated detection of any basophils. A CBC may be useful as a screening test for underlying infection, anemia and illness. WebBasophils are considered rare in normal dogs and cats. However, basophilia (defined as finding 1 or more basophils during a manual Diff and reported as ≥100/µl or 0.1 × 10 9 /L) was seen in 8% of Swedish canine patients. WebKeratitis sicca is a "dry eye" syndrome that occurs in dogs. It can occur in either a primary form or secondary to chronic use of sulfonamides. It results from immune-mediated destruction of the lacrimal glands and is similar to Sjögren syndrome of people. Affected dogs may respond favorably to cyclosporine eye drops. The basophil (on the right) is larger than the neutrophil and has a long mildly lobulated ribbon-like nucleus. (b) Canine basophil with unevenly scattered dark purplish cytoplasmic granules against a pale grey–blue cytoplasm.
